What makes full-care boarding different from pasture boarding?
Full-care boarding means the facility handles all daily needs for your horse, including feeding, stall cleaning, blanketing, and turnout. Pasture boarding is a lower-cost option where your horse lives outside in a shared field with basic feeding provided but fewer individual services.
Is there a minimum boarding commitment at facilities like this one?
Many Indiana boarding stables require a monthly commitment, often with a 30-day notice period if you plan to leave. Some facilities offer short-term or trial boarding for new clients who want to test the fit before signing a longer arrangement.
How do I find out if a boarding facility is reputable before committing?
Visiting in person is the most reliable way to judge a facility's quality. Talk to current boarders if possible, and look for clean water sources, healthy-looking horses, organized tack rooms, and staff who can answer your care questions clearly and confidently.

What should I expect to pay for horse boarding near Greenwood, Indiana?
In Johnson County and the greater Indianapolis area, full-care stall boarding typically runs between $400 and $700 per month depending on stall size, amenities, and included services. Facilities with additional features like an inn property or event space may price at the higher end of that range.
